The optionally input mode and generally count function make the chip fit for lots of occasions, such as used widely in all kinds of electric iron, kneading seat, parking time alarm, controller of various home wiring. Can offer autotimer and autocontrol at will. Periphery circuit of the chip is simple. We can offer power for the chip by receding the voltage of 220V directly. The chip works in 32768hz frequency. In chip, it can double up voltage, in order to make 4 figures LCD come true. It can set seconds and minutes independently, and have several output modes such as LED, buzzer, 0.25Hz wave, high and low switch of voltage. Design of the chip have gone through several steps: market investigate and the programming of the product empolder; study detailed problem of yielding technics; design the frame of the chip (set down the calendar of the design work); study the systematic structure and modules'circuit of the chip; Verilog HDL for the modules is described; and the functional simulation and synthesis are carried out; validate the design. In the chip, the seven segments LCD of electronic timer are presented. Reduce the current and power consume with the manner of scanning display. Save the hardware resources and improve the reliability base on FPGA characteristic.
